Iniciar en el mundo de la programación puede parecer un desafío, pero con los recursos y el enfoque adecuado, cualquier persona puede aprender. En este artículo, exploraremos cómo comenzar a programar desde cero utilizando dos de los lenguajes más populares: Python y JavaScript. Además, destacaremos la relevancia de la educación guiada a través de Bootcamps en programación para optimizar tu aprendizaje.

¿Por Qué Elegir Python y JavaScript?

Python y JavaScript son lenguajes de programación ideales para principiantes gracias a su sintaxis accesible y su amplia gama de aplicaciones. Python es conocido por ser fácil de leer y versátil, usándose en campos como el desarrollo web, la ciencia de datos y la automatización. Por otro lado, JavaScript es fundamental para el desarrollo web, permitiendo la creación de sitios interactivos y aplicaciones dinámicas en el navegador.

Herramientas Para Iniciar

Antes de sumergirnos en los conceptos clave, es importante equiparse con las herramientas adecuadas. Aquí te ofrecemos algunas recomendaciones para empezar:

  1. Entornos de Desarrollo Integrado (IDE):
  1. Plataformas de Aprendizaje:

Conceptos Básicos en Python y JavaScript

Para comenzar a programar, es esencial comprender algunos conceptos fundamentales en ambos lenguajes. A continuación, te mostramos algunos ejemplos básicos:

Python

  1. Variables y Tipos de Datos:
   # Asignación de una variable de tipo cadena
   nombre = "Ana"
   # Asignación de una variable de tipo entero
   edad = 28
  1. Estructuras de Control:
   if edad >= 18:
       print("Eres mayor de edad")
   else:
       print("Eres menor de edad")
  1. Funciones:
   def saludar(nombre):
       return f"Hola, {nombre}!"

   print(saludar("Ana"))

JavaScript

  1. Variables y Tipos de Datos:
   // Declaración de una variable de tipo cadena
   let nombre = "Carlos";
   // Declaración de una variable de tipo entero
   let edad = 22;
  1. Estructuras de Control:
   if (edad >= 18) {
       console.log("Eres mayor de edad");
   } else {
       console.log("Eres menor de edad");
   }
  1. Funciones:
   function saludar(nombre) {
       return "Hola, " + nombre + "!";
   }

   console.log(saludar("Carlos"));

La Importancia de la Educación Guiada: Bootcamps

Aunque es posible aprender a programar de manera autodidacta, este proceso puede ser largo y complicado. Aquí es donde los Bootcamps de programación se convierten en una opción valiosa.

Los Bootcamps son programas intensivos diseñados para sumergirte en la programación, ofreciendo una estructura clara y apoyo continuo por parte de instructores con experiencia. Algunos de los principales beneficios incluyen:

  1. Plan de Estudios Estructurado: Los Bootcamps siguen un plan de estudios cuidadosamente diseñado para llevarte de ser un principiante a un programador competente en un corto período de tiempo.
  2. Enfoque Práctico: En lugar de enfocarse solo en la teoría, los Bootcamps te permiten trabajar en proyectos reales, dándote la experiencia práctica necesaria para dominar la programación.
  3. Red de Contactos y Oportunidades Laborales: Muchos Bootcamps tienen conexiones con empresas tecnológicas y te ayudan a preparar tu portfolio y a buscar empleo al finalizar el programa.

Conclusión

Aprender a programar desde cero con Python y JavaScript es una excelente manera de invertir en tu futuro. Con las herramientas y recursos adecuados, puedes desarrollar una sólida base en programación. Si deseas acelerar tu aprendizaje y recibir una formación más estructurada, un Bootcamp puede ser una excelente opción.

Sea cual sea el camino que elijas, recuerda que la clave para tener éxito en la programación es la práctica constante y la perseverancia. ¡Mucho éxito en tu viaje para convertirte en programador!

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*